c8ee55ed19 feat(testing): add FaultInjector framework for StubLlm (#1233)
* feat(testing): add FaultInjector framework for StubLlm (#1220)

Adds a configurable fault injection framework for testing retry, failover,
and circuit breaker behavior. The FaultInjector attaches to StubLlm and
provides per-call control over failure type, timing, and sequencing.

Components:
- FaultType: maps to LlmError variants (RequestFailed, RateLimited,
  AuthFailed, InvalidResponse, IoError, ContextLengthExceeded, SessionExpired)
- FaultAction: Succeed, Fail(FaultType), Delay(Duration)
- FaultMode: SequenceOnce (play then succeed), SequenceLoop (repeat forever),
  Random (seeded xorshift64 PRNG for reproducibility)
- FaultInjector: thread-safe (AtomicU32 counter + Mutex RNG)

Integration:
- StubLlm gains optional fault_injector field via with_fault_injector()
- When set, takes precedence over should_fail/error_kind
- Backward compatible: existing StubLlm usage unchanged

76375f2eaa refactor: centralize test credential constants into testing::credentials (#829)
* refactor: centralize test credential constants into testing::credentials

Scattered test credential strings (API keys, OAuth tokens, crypto keys,
Telegram tokens, session tokens) across ~25 files made security auditing
harder and created unnecessary duplication. Centralize all test-only fake
credentials into a new `src/testing/credentials.rs` module with named
constants and a shared `test_secrets_store()` helper.

- Convert `src/testing.rs` to directory module (`src/testing/mod.rs`)
- Add `src/testing/credentials.rs` with ~30 named constants
- Replace hardcoded literals in 24 source files
- Deduplicate `test_store()` helper (was copy-pasted in 3 files)
- Leave leak_detector/shell/signature tests as-is (inline values
  aid readability for pattern detection tests)
